Rock water supposed to be decent, they also run water and sand cans. Brady, another sand can company, or go to Nuverra / power fuels where I’ve worked 4 1/2 years, water and side dump, winch trucks, $3,000 sign on bonus right now, $5 per hour night pay and I get $2000 referral bonus
